titleOfInvention | method to produce saccharified solution by enzymatic technique using cellulosic biomass as raw material |
abstract | the present invention relates to the provision of a method of producing a saccharified solution, in which the cellulosic biomass is solubilized by enzymatic hydrolysis of the cellulose contained in the cellulosic biomass, the method being adapted to quickly solubilize the biomass, and to give a slurry , while maintaining a high concentration of solids in a reaction flask. the pulverized biomass and an aqueous solution, containing the enzyme hydrolyzing cellulose, are mixed in a reaction flask not including any deflector plates disposed inside, and the cellulosic biomass is solubilized under agitation. later, the contents of the reaction flask are transferred to another reaction flask, including a baffle plate disposed inside, and the enzymatic hydrolysis of the cellulose is allowed to proceed. the concentration of solids in the first reaction flask is preferably 15 to 30% by weight. the efficiency of agitation during enzymatic cellulose hydrolysis is enhanced, and in this way the amount of sugar production can be increased. |
